Converting pictures to black and white makes the picture look bold and classic. Such as anything in art, people will have different feelings towards a picture. Black and white is rich due to the fact that there will be a different sensations on who you ask and what the picture is. There is a large collection of of shading and texture in black and white photography. An example of shading is hair, hair will have light spots while other parts will be darker. In portraits, the human skin has a large amount of textures. No matter if the skin is soft and young or the skin has wrinkles and old.
